BACKGROUND AND DISCUSSION
The MHB is comprised of fifteen members from a diverse background. The MHB includes Supervisor Gregory, family members of people experiencing mental illness, concerned citizens and consumers. The MHB members participate in fifteen committees and workgroups in the County that are focused on critical key areas of mental health services, including, among others, the Promoting Integrated Care Workgroup, Cultural Competency Committee and Veterans Commission. The purpose of the MHB is to support HHSA in the provision of high-quality mental health services and programs across Napa County.
